MC10EP08DG belongs to the category of integrated circuits (ICs).
This product is commonly used in electronic devices for signal processing and data transmission.
MC10EP08DG is available in a small outline integrated circuit (SOIC) package.
The essence of MC10EP08DG lies in its ability to process high-frequency signals accurately and efficiently.

MC10EP08DG operates based on differential signaling, where the voltage difference between two input signals determines the output state. It utilizes advanced semiconductor technology to achieve high-speed operation and accurate signal processing.
